Preparation is important in every area of life.
Proverbs 30:25 says, “The ants are a people not strong, yet they prepare their meat in the summer…” The ants are given to us as an example. Though they are not strong, they are diligent [hard working] and prudent [foreseeing]. The realization that there is coming a time when they will not be able to work is instinctive to these little creatures.
The Word of God teaches believers that there is coming a time when our work here on earth will be done. There is coming a time when we will no longer be able to work. Here are some questions:
1. Are you personally ready to meet the Lord? Ye must be born again!
2. Are you preparing others to meet the Lord? Who have you shared the Gospel with recently?
3. Are you preparing others to prepare others? Yep, you read that right! Are you teaching others to teach others?
Prepare while you are in your summer, because there will come a time when you will have to live with the FRUIT of your DECISIONS.
